Motorcycle Mechanics Salary in Southwest Maine nonmetropolitan area
The median pay for a motorcycle mechanics in Southwest Maine nonmetropolitan area is $48,140/year ($23.14/hour), per BLS data. The range runs from $38K at the entry level to $60K for experienced workers.

Compensation breakdown
Annual earnings by percentile, Southwest Maine nonmetropolitan area
Entry-level motorcycle mechanics (10th percentile) start around $38K. Mid-career wages sit at $48K. Top earners bring in $60K or more, a $22K spread from bottom to top.

Frequently asked questions
How much do motorcycle mechanics make in Southwest Maine nonmetropolitan area?
The median is $48,140 a year, that works out to about $23 an hour. But the range is wide: entry-level workers start around $37,820, and experienced motorcycle mechanics can clear $60,110. These are BLS numbers, based on employer-reported data, not self-reported surveys.
Is $48K enough to live in Southwest Maine nonmetropolitan area?
On that salary, you'd take home roughly $3,224/month after taxes. A 2-bedroom here rents for about $1,412/month, which eats 43.8% of your paycheck. That's above the 30% rule of thumb, housing will be a stretch at the median salary, though you can manage with roommates or a smaller place.
How far does a motorcycle mechanics salary go in Southwest Maine nonmetropolitan area?
Southwest Maine nonmetropolitan area has a Regional Price Parity of 100 (100 is the national average). That's right at the national average. After cost-of-living adjustment, the median motorcycle mechanics salary is worth about $48,140 in national-average purchasing power.
